Transaction 52d0170d49ae4545fc808b26669643a879f45f6888d0999f15da173e5ee084b1

block
e4cbc6f61f4e1dd18110ce21edbb901ede457305efee235d0bbb275edb22e7b3

12 Inputs

2 Outputs